【参加CUDA线上训练营】零基础cuda,一文认识cuda基本概念
- 1.术语
- 2.线程层次
- 2.1 Block、Warp与Thread之间的关系
- 2.2 Thread index
1.术语
\\%
序号 | 名称 | 描述 |
---|---|---|
1 | Host | CPU和内存(host memory) |
2 | Device | GPU和显存(device memory) |
3 | SM | Streaming Multiprocessor |
4 | Thread | sequential execution unit \\% 所有线程并行执行的相同的核函数 |
5 | Thread Block | 执行在同一个SM中的a group of threads,这些线程可以协作 \\% 一个block内的线程一定会在同一个SM中,但一个SM可以有很多个block。 |
6 | Thread Grid | a collection of thread blocks,这些blcoks可以在多个SM中执行 |
7 | Warp | Warp调度器为了提高运行效率,会将每32个线程分为一组,称作一个Warp |